What can I see and do near Twin City Model Railroad Museum?
Study the collections at Mill City Museum, Minnesota History Center, or Minneapolis Institute of Art. Explore notable local landmarks like Stone Arch Bridge, Cathedral of Saint Paul, and Foshay Tower. You can check out the local talent at Guthrie Theater, The Armory, and Fitzgerald Theater.
